  3.  Why Consider Conservatory Refurbishment? Conservatories work as versatile areas for relaxation, dining, or even working from home. However, the list below factors frequently prompt property owners to think about refurbishment:
  4.  Aesthetic Update: Trends in home style progress regularly. An out-of-date conservatory design can diminish the total worth of a home and might no longer fulfill the homeowner's design preferences.
  5.  Functionality: A conservatory needs to improve living areas. As requirements alter-- whether a household grows, or a new pastime takes shape-- a refurbishment can create a location more suited to modern-day way of lives.
  6.  Energy Efficiency: Older conservatories may not be equipped with modern-day insulation or glazing technology, causing temperature level variations and greater energy expenses. Refurbishing can address this concern, making the conservatory more sustainable and cost-effective.
  7.  Repair and Maintenance Needs: Wear and tear are inescapable. If components like roof, windows, or doors are damaged or overly aged, a refurbishment supplies a chance for necessary repairs.
  8.  Improved Resale Value: Potential buyers are often attracted to homes with properly maintained and visually attractive conservatories. Investing in refurbishment can enhance the residential or commercial property's marketability.
  9.  Actions to Refurbishing a Conservatory Reconditioning a conservatory is a multi-faceted procedure needing thoughtful preparation. Here are necessary actions property owners should consider:
  10.  1. Examining the Current State Before diving into the refurbishment procedure, it's vital to assess the condition of the conservatory. This evaluation ought to cover:
  11.  Structural integrity of the structure State of the glazing and roofing Condition of associated components such as doors and heating Quality of insulation 2. Specifying the Purpose Selecting the main function of the conservatory post-refurbishment can assist form the style choices. Consider these choices:
  12.  A relaxation area with comfy seating A hobby or craft space An outdoor dining area A green space for plants and foliage 3. Setting a Budget Every refurbishment needs to begin with a budget plan. Aspects to consider include:
  13.  Materials used for building and construction and decoration Furnishings and fixtures Labor costs (if contracting professional assistance) Permits or structural changes 4. Selecting Design Elements The aesthetic aspects of the refurbishment are essential. Consider incorporating:
  14.  Modern glazing choices for energy effectiveness and design Color design that complement the main home Floor covering that is both durable and aesthetically appealing Lighting aspects to boost the ambiance 5. Working With Professionals or DIY Depending upon the job's scope and the property owner's skills, they might select:
  15.  Hiring Professionals: A knowledgeable team can offer insights, save time, and potentially avoid costly errors. Do It Yourself: For small repairs such as designing or simple remodellings, a DIY technique can be both fulfilling and affordable. 6. Acquiring Necessary Permits Depending upon the degree of the repairs, it may be necessary to protect structure permits. This is specifically true if you intend on structural changes or extending the conservatory.
  16.  7. Implementation and Final Touches Once plans are strengthened, the refurbishment can begin. Homeowners must ensure they take regular updates if working with professionals, keeping an eye on timelines and quality of work.

Frequently Asked Questions about Conservatory Refurbishment Q1: How long does a typical conservatory refurbishment take?A: The duration differs significantly based upon the scope of work. Small updates may take a few days, while thorough refurbishments can last several weeks.
  19.  Q2: Do I require preparing permission for a conservatory refurbishment?A: It depends on the level of the work. If you are modifying the structure significantly, it's best to talk to regional authorities regarding preparation permissions.
  20.  Q3: What is the typical cost of refurbishing a conservatory?A: Costs vary commonly based upon aspects such as size, materials, and design. Typically, homeowners can anticipate to spend anywhere from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 20,000 or more.
  21.  Q4: Can I refurbish my conservatory on a budget plan?A: Yes, by preparing thoroughly, focusing on vital changes, and checking out affordable products and DIY alternatives, a successful refurbishment can be attained within monetary restrictions.
  22.  Q5: Is it possible to increase the size of my conservatory during refurbishment?A: Yes, increasing the size is a common refurbishment enhancement. However, structural modifications may need preparation approvals and professional input.
